Overall sentiment: Reviews for Vintage Hills are uniformly positive, emphasizing high-quality personal care, a warm, home-like environment, and attentive staff. Multiple reviewers explicitly recommend the facility and describe their experiences as exceptionally good, citing cleanliness, comfort, and compassionate treatment as recurring strengths.
Care quality and staff: A central theme across the reviews is the strength and compassion of the caregiving team. Reviewers describe staff and owners as kind, loving, knowledgeable, and respectful. One review specifically notes a nurse practitioner with a psychiatric background on staff, indicating clinical expertise beyond basic caregiving. Several reviewers singled out the facility’s handling of end-of-life care — keeping residents clean, comfortable, and treated respectfully — which points to competence in both routine care and more intensive, sensitive situations. An open visiting policy was mentioned positively and supports a family-friendly approach.
Facilities and accommodations: The facility is repeatedly described as very clean, neat, immaculate, and welcoming. Rooms are characterized as comfortable and of a good size; one review notes a shared master bedroom that includes an en suite and a large shower. Common spaces and seating areas are mentioned as pleasant, and Direct TV is available in at least some rooms or lounges. The home’s backyard and outdoor area are appreciated, and reviewers note a quiet, walkable neighborhood with sidewalks.
Dining and services: Dining receives favorable comments — meals are described as tasty, and reviewers appreciate that outside meals are accommodated at no charge. Seating and dining spaces are noted as comfortable, which reinforces the homey, family-style atmosphere described elsewhere.
Atmosphere and community: Multiple reviewers emphasize the small, family-style setting and homey atmosphere. The combination of a small size, friendly staff, and a quiet neighborhood creates an intimate, relaxed environment that reviewers found comforting for their family members.
Notable strengths and patterns: The reviews consistently highlight three main strengths: cleanliness of the facility, the personal and compassionate quality of staff, and comfortable accommodations. Specific operational positives — like having a nurse practitioner with psychiatric experience and an open visiting policy — distinguish Vintage Hills as clinically attentive while remaining family-oriented. Several reviewers explicitly state they would highly recommend the home.
Concerns and limitations: The only explicit concern raised in the reviews relates to privacy in shared-room arrangements: a shared master bedroom is divided by a curtain between beds, which some may view as limited privacy. No other negative operational issues (e.g., staffing shortages, cleanliness complaints, billing concerns) were mentioned in these summaries.
Context and caveats: The collected summaries represent a small sample and are uniformly positive, which suggests consistently strong performance in the areas noted but may also reflect reporting bias (satisfied families are often more motivated to leave reviews). Nevertheless, the specifics cited — clinical staffing with psychiatric expertise, praised end-of-life care, open visiting, clean and comfortable rooms, outdoor space, and accommodating meal policies — together form a coherent picture of a small, well-run residential care setting that prioritizes individualized, compassionate care.
Bottom line: Based on these reviews, Vintage Hills appears to be a clean, comfortable, and family-oriented care home with caring and competent staff, strong end-of-life care practices, pleasant indoor and outdoor spaces, and a number of practical conveniences (Direct TV, outside meals allowed). The main consideration for prospective residents is the degree of privacy in shared rooms where a curtain separates beds; otherwise, reviewers repeatedly endorse the facility and its staff.
